Firstly there’s GLaDOS from Portal. I like how in Portal 1 she seems like a regular robotic voice guide for the testers (and especially Chell), and even with some of the unethical workplace testing lines she delivers, but never anything to indicate she’s sentient. She can actually call you a horrible person early on in one of the test chambers, but it’s optional so the player can completely miss it.
Then after the tests are over and the player gets rewarded (with fire), her mask slips a bit after the player escapes. Then while continuing to escape, GLaDOS drops all pretenses of ever wanting to help you and starts talking to the player in a “I’m not mad, just disappointed, and also I hate you” kind of way. And it’s wonderful.
Don’t think I need to explain too much about GLaDOS because she is an iconic video game character (or at least I think she is). Portal 2 is where she shines the most, but I also wanted to highlight the first game as well. One of the best things that happens is you teaming up with her in a “the enemy of my enemy is my friend” sort of deal when she gets put in a potato battery and can do literally nothing.
There’s also the sympathetic element with her when it’s revealed she used to be a human named Caroline whose brain was put into a supercomputer because of the dying wishes of her boss (another great performance by JK Simmons but also fuck you Cave Johnson). So a lot of what GLaDOS does, while not morally right (morals? In Aperture Laboratories?), it’s also understandable why she turned out this way.
Also I was never a believer of the “Caroline is Chell’s mom” theory, but now that I’ve grown up and can understand that a lot of Glados’s dialogue can also sound like it’s being said by a bitter ex, it only makes her even funnier in my mind. I’ve said before that Portal 2 is one of my favorite games and one of the main reasons is because of her. Ellen McLain does a great job portraying her and is given some funny lines, as well as singing three of the greatest songs in this game (Still Alive, Turret Opera, and Want You Gone).
Speaking of characters that used to be human and whose voice actor gives a great performance.
I love Snatcher. Glados was my favorite for a while and then he showed up. I think one of the reasons I gravitate towards him more is that I’m generally more interested in ghosts rather than robots. He can also be very intimidating, with him stealing the players soul and straight up killing the player if you refuse to sign his first contract. But also he looks like this:
(this used to be my discord icon for a while)
I like silly goofy character designs, what can I say?
As I said before, Snatcher also has a sympathetic backstory with him once being a prince. Then his lover, Vanessa, locked him up in the basement of her manor when she thought he was cheating on her (he wasn’t), then everyone in the kingdom died, including him, then in between all that he became known as The Snatcher and now rules Subcon Forest.
This wasn’t even supposed to be his backstory, but it was after the character it was made for (never forget Moonjumper) was cut from the final version of the game. This backstory isn’t important overall to the main game as Subcon Forest is only part of the overall game (I have not played the Vanessa’s Curse DLC where I know it’s brought up again) but even without the backstory I would’ve considered him my favorite character of all time. He’s funny, he’s goofy looking, he’s a “soon-deh-ray” (as his steam trading card calls him), and he’s amazing. (Also 'Your Contract Has Expired' is a great track).
